What is a Non-Surgical Face Lift?
The goal of a non-surgical face lift is to renew the face's appearance without the need for surgery. A non-surgical face lift, in contrast to a typical face lift, uses a variety of methods to lift, firm, and tighten the skin without making incisions or removing superfluous skin.
Injectables like Botox and dermal fillers, as well as minimally invasive techniques like ultrasound, radiofrequency, and laser therapy, are among popular non-surgical face lift treatments. These procedures work to tighten the skin, reduce wrinkles and fine lines, and boost collagen synthesis, giving the patient a more young, revitalized appearance.
Non-surgical face lifts are a common option for those who want to enhance their looks without committing to surgery because they are frequently more affordable, less hazardous, and need less recovery time than surgical procedures.

Types of Facelift Injections
Following are the types of facelift injections:
Botox
Botox, a neurotoxin, is injected into the facial muscles to smooth out wrinkles and fine lines. It functions by preventing the signals that tell muscles to contract, which can aid in reducing forehead, eye, and lip wrinkles.
Dermal fillers
Injectable gels used to give volume to areas of the face that have lost suppleness over time are called dermal fillers. They can be used to fill in deep wrinkles and folds as well as to accentuate the cheeks, lips, and under-eye region.
Kybella
To lessen the appearance of a double chin, Kybella is an injectable procedure. It functions by obliterating fat cells under the chin, which might assist to define and contour the jawline.
Sculptra
Sculptra is a kind of dermal filler that is employed to encourage the skin's collagen production. It can be applied to re-inflate the cheeks, temples, and other parts of the face that have lost volume due to aging and elasticity loss.
Platelet-rich plasma (PRP) therapy
A concentrated serum of the patient's own platelets is injected under the skin during platelet-rich plasma (PRP) therapy. It is a popular choice for people who wish to enhance the general condition of their skin because it can assist in stimulating collagen formation and enhancing skin texture and tone.
It's crucial to remember that each of these treatments has certain advantages and risks, and not all patients may respond well to all of them. Based on each patient's unique needs and goals, an expert practitioner can assist in determining which course of treatment is best for that patient.

What are the Potential Risks of Dermal Face Fillers?
Dermal fillers are generally regarded as safe when used by a trained and skilled professional, although there are some side effects and difficulties. Among these dangers are:
Allergic reactions: The filler material may induce an allergic reaction in certain patients, resulting in redness, swelling, and itching.
Infection: If the skin is penetrated, there is a chance of infection, which can cause swelling, discomfort, and redness.
Lumps and bumps: If the filler is not applied uniformly, it may cause the skin to develop lumps or bumps.
Migration: Dermal fillers can migrate away from the area of injection, leading to asymmetry or an unnatural look.
Swelling and bruising: Dermal filler injections frequently cause swelling and bruising, especially around the mouth and eyes.
Prior to receiving treatment, patients should have a discussion with their doctor about the possible risks and problems of dermal fillers. Patients should also carefully follow all post-treatment recommendations to reduce the risk of complications.
How much time does it take to recover after getting Facelift Filler?
Depending on the patient and the particular filler utilized, the recovery period following a facelift can change. Patients should often anticipate some minimal post-injection edema, bruising, and redness in the treated area.
The majority of patients can resume their regular activities right away after the procedure, while some might choose to take a day or two off work to let the swelling go down. For at least 24 hours following the injection, patients should refrain from touching or scratching the treated region as well as engaging in intense activity.
Also, it's crucial for patients to go by any post-treatment advice given by their doctor, which may include using cold compresses or ice on the treated area and staying away from medicines that raise the possibility of bruising.
Once the filler material settles and fuses with the surrounding tissue, the full effects of a facelift filler may not be seen for many days or even weeks. Patients may occasionally need several treatments to get the outcomes they want.
How long does Facelift Injections last?
The precise type of injection used, as well as individual characteristics including the patient's age, skin type, and lifestyle habits, can affect how long the results of a facelift injection last.
Generally speaking, the majority of facelift injections provide transient effects that can last anywhere from a few months to a year or more. Hyaluronic acid fillers, for example, typically last between six months to one year, whereas Sculptra has a two-year shelf life.
Factors including sun exposure, smoking, and drinking alcohol might shorten the length of the benefits by accelerating the breakdown of the filler material, which can also have an impact on how long the results last.
In order to preserve the effects of their facelift injections over time, patients who are interested in doing so might collaborate with their doctor to create a treatment plan that includes touch-up injections at regular intervals. Also, making lifestyle adjustments like quitting smoking and wearing sunscreen can assist to extend the effects of the injections.

Can fillers lift the lower face?
Certainly, fillers can elevate the lower face and make skin that is sagging or drooping seem better. This is frequently accomplished by adding volume to areas like the cheeks and chin with dermal fillers, which can lift and shape the lower face.
Certain fillers not only increase volume but also encourage the skin to produce more collagen, which can further lessen the look of drooping or loose skin. A practitioner may advise a mix of several filler types and procedures to achieve the desired lifting effect in the lower face, depending on the specific demands of the patient.
What happens when face filler wears off?
The effects of the injection will progressively fade over time as the facial filler wears off. When the filler material is broken down and absorbed by the body, the skin will gradually regain its appearance before the procedure.
The particular filler used, as well as individual characteristics including the patient's age, skin type, and lifestyle choices, can all affect how quickly filler fades out. In general, fillers offer transient effects that persist for a few months to a year or longer.
